Hello,

I am trying to update my multimedia howto for Qubes and would like to use
a  fedora-29--minimal template instead of debian.

I try to install a package via snap but the template VM is not allowed to
access the repository:

snap install , results in:
api.snapcraft.io ... read: connection refused.

Question:
What are the correct steps to allow internet access for the template VM?
If possible only to api.snapcraft.io?

I looked at the Qubes docs https://www.qubes-os.org/doc/software-update-vm/
but couldn't find a solution, can someone point me into the right direction?
